How much does it cost to rent a home in Homestead?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Homestead 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,479 | $800 | $2,500 |
Homestead 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,842 | $1,095 | $2,800 |
Homestead 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,666 | $1,195 | $6,695 |
Homestead 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,658 | $2,090 | $3,750 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Homestead
What type of rentals are currently available in Homestead?
There are currently 351 Apartments for Rent in Homestead, PA with pricing that ranges from $650 to $4,692. There are also 77 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Homestead ranging from $750 to $6,695.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Homestead?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Homestead ranges from $750 to $6,695 with an average monthly rent of $1,909.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Homestead?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Homestead range from $1,250 to $4,692,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,095 to $2,800.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,195 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,200.
